How to fill out the Solid Wastes of Willits Application for Employment online
Filling out the Solid Wastes of Willits Application for Employment online is a straightforward process that can help you take the first step in joining a dedicated team. This guide will walk you through each section of the application, ensuring that you provide all necessary information accurately and efficiently.
Follow the steps to complete your application with ease.
- Click the 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the application form and open it for editing.
- Select your desired position by indicating whether you are applying for part-time or full-time work.
- Fill in the date of your application, followed by your name, including last, first, and middle names along with your social security number.
- Provide your current phone number and address, specifying how long you have been at your residence. Include your previous address if applicable.
- Answer the first question regarding prior employment with the company, providing position and dates if applicable.
- Respond to the criminal history questions by indicating yes or no and providing dates and details if necessary.
- List your employment history chronologically, including all previous employers, job titles, dates of employment, reasons for leaving, and tasks performed.
- Explain any gaps in your employment history and indicate if your current employer can be contacted.
- Answer questions related to your qualifications, experience, and ability to perform the job duties, as well as your transportation means to work.
- Complete the education section, listing schools attended, years completed, and any relevant degrees or certifications.
- Provide personal references, including names, occupations, addresses, and how long you have known them.
- Read the applicant’s statement and agreement carefully before signing and dating the application.
